Pastel Supplies:

Pastels are fun AND pricey, so I have created two kits here, pick you comfort level:

More Fun:

  • Sennelier 80 Half-stick Set.

  • NuPastels 12 stick set.

More Reasonable but also capable of making great paintings:

  • Sennelier 40 half-stick set.

  • Nu Pastels 24 stick set or 12 stick set.

You will also need for both sets:

  • Art Spectrum Sanded Paper 11 x 14 pad of ten or similar.

  • A worn out or really, really cheap bristle brush—this is your eraser. I’ll give you one if you don’t have one.

  • About a cup of Gamsol or isopropyl alcohol in a shatterproof container. (A small format nalgene works great).

  • Paper Towels (VIVA!), but really, anything except the towels available in the studio.

  • Small sketchbook and pencil or pen.

  • Workable Fixative— !Never use indoors! !Not good to breathe!
    There is a non-toxic casein alternative, but I have never had good luck with it.

    Optional but nice:

  • A pad of tracing paper that is larger than your sanded papers for easy transport, or parchment paper.

  • A portfolio for carrying pastels around
